Deliver to Ireland
For best experience Get the App
Nabco NE51 41 990A Clutch Master CylinderNo Core Charge RequiredParts Interchange NE5141990A, NE51 41 990A, 55532018330, 555 32018 330
Trustpilot
Neha S.
2 weeks ago
Ravi S.
2 months ago
Yusuf A.
1 month ago
Ayesha M.
5 days ago